Happy Sumo Japanese Steak

Happy Sumo Japanese Steak is listed under the Japanese Restaurants category (which is under the following categories: Restaurants & Bars -> Restaurants). They are listed as being a B2C (business to consumer) company. Happy Sumo Japanese Steak was founded in 1997. They are located at 6135 Peachtree Parkway # 610 in Norcross, Georgia.
Mobile and regular directions can be viewed below as well as their phone number, ratings, website (when listed).


Driving Directions
Address:
Happy Sumo Japanese Steak
6135 Peachtree Parkway # 610
Norcross, Georgia 30092
Get mobile directions from current location:
or enter a starting address:


Phone Number: 770-248-0203
Website: happysumorest.com
Industry: Accommodation and Food Services
Happy Sumo Japanese Steak Location
Happy Sumo Japanese Steak Location

Happy Sumo Japanese Steak Reviews & Additional Information

Happy Sumo Japanese Steak Reviews and Ratings
Average Local Rating

0 out of 5 stars from 0 reviews.

Average Customer Star Rating
19002954-Happy Sumo Japanese Steak

Reviews

We currently have no ratings or reviews for this Japanese Restaurants listing. If you have used their services before please think about leaving a review for future visitors to this page and potential Happy Sumo Japanese Steak patrons.


Japanese Restaurants Listings in Norcross
The following Japanese Restaurants profiles are also available in Norcross
Aomi Japanese Restaurant
5145 Peachtree Parkway
Asahi Japanese Restaurant
5495 Jimmy Carter Boulevard
Happy Sumo Japanese Steak
6135 Peachtree Parkway # 610
Hibachi
3230 Medlock Bridge Road # 106
Lin Jack Enterprises Inc
1210 Rockbridge Road
Yap & Chan Inc
6584 Wandering Way